3. Casa Blanca Lily. Casa Blanca is a hybrid Oriental lily, these Lily plant is known by its scientific name Lilium Casa Blanca. It has tall stems that grow up to three to four feet high, holding large dark green leaves topped with beautiful showy white flowers, which bloom in mid to late summer.

How to grow and care for blueberry lily. Choose a spot in full sun or shade with well-drained soil. Mix in plenty of organic matter, including compost and well-rotted manure, and fork in well. If growing in a pot, use a premium quality potting mix. Dig a hole twice as wide and the same depth as the existing root ball.

Madonna lily is a classic white lily indigenous to the Middle Eastern region. People have been cultivating it for food and show for over 2000 years. Madonna lilies have broad crisp white petals, which sometimes have a pale green center. Each flower of the Madonna lily measures around 2-3 inches long, and they produce a lovely fragrance.

In spring to early summer most lilly pillies have fluffy white or greenish flowers followed by long lasting red, purple or whitish berries. The fruit matures from December to February, being a pear shaped red berry, known as a Riberry, growing to 13 mm long, covering a single seed, 4 mm in diameter.

Lily of the valley is a woodland flowering plant with bell-shaped, fragrant white flowers and small, orange-red berries. The red berries are round and measure 0.2" to 0.3" (5 - 7 mm) in diameter. They grow on stems that emerge from the plant's base, just above the ground. Lily of the valley is primarily grown for its fragrant white flowers.

There are numerous native Australian plants that are referred to as lilies. However, most of them are actually native orchids or gingers. These include the Sydney Rock Lily, the Gymea Lily, the Cape York Lily, the Blue Grass Lily, and plants in the Dianella species. There's also the Vanilla Lily that is native to the Ballarat area in Victoria.
